Hello, Last Year, I bought this barebones kit from MagicMicro.
It has an ASUS P5B-F Motherboard. Now, I am planning to upgrade the processor to a Quad Core Q6600 Processor. What will I need to do to perform this upgrade? Will my CPU fan still work with it or must I need a higher CPU fan? I am not sure what fan I got, but it came with my pentium d processor.
Kute Punk Kay Pee Kay Tee Pren Tiss Kute Punk Kay Pee Kay Tee Pren Tiss
Name: jam Date: November 17, 2007 at 19:18:34 Pacific
Reply:
You'll have to update the BIOS before you install the quad...other than that, just make sure to get the retail CPU version & use the HSF that's packaged with it.
